Letter to Premier Regarding Fuel Prices
Dear Members,
Like all Nova Scotians, we are all dealing with the effects of skyrocketing gasoline prices. This is especially true for members who are required to use their own vehicles to deliver services to Nova Scotians. Earlier today I wrote to Premier Houston asking that he work with us in developing a solution to deal with drastic increases in gasoline and diesel.
Discussions are taking place with Government and we hope to have more information in the near future. Click here to see a copy of the letter to Premier Houston.
